A strong VP of Customer Success creates the operating model behind retention and expansion. They align onboarding, adoption, customer health, renewals, executive relationships, team structure, segmentation, metrics, and cross-functional execution around durable customer value.
Build stronger customer health, renewal discipline, risk management, executive engagement, and proactive intervention.
Create a post-sale growth model that identifies customer outcomes, expansion opportunities, cross-sell, upsell, and strategic account potential.
Design segmentation, coverage models, leadership layers, playbooks, systems, roles, metrics, and career paths for a growing team.
Customer Success leadership sits at the intersection of customer outcomes and revenue. The strongest leaders can coach teams, influence Product and Sales, communicate with executives, stabilize critical accounts, and turn customer signals into operating priorities.
